MOVIE SUMMARY
NOTE: This movie is not fully based on Lois Duncan's Killing Mr. Griffin, but it was inspired (to an extent) by the book, so I added it up here. Here is what Lois Duncan said at CNN's Ask the Author (link no longer available):
Kevin Williamson (who wrote the film script for I KNOW WHAT YOU DID LAST SUMMER) says KILLING MRS. TINGLE is his own original story, and he's had the film script sitting in a desk drawer for years.Maybe it's mere coincidence that, a number of years ago, a movie company that had an option on KILLING MR. GRIFFIN hired Kevin Williamson to write the film script. The option ran out, and the company tried to convince me to renew it by showing me Mr. Williamson's "wonderful script." It was so violent and the story was so far removed from my book that I refused to renew the option, and Mr. Williamson was, understandably, not at all happy. I, then, sold the option to GRIFFIN to another studio, who had another writer write a script, and it was made into a very good TV film which was an NBC Movie of the Week.
I've often wondered what happened to Kevin Williamson's unused script.
Teaching Mrs. Tingle was released August 20, 1999 staring Katie Holmes (Dawson's Creek) and Helen Mirren (British actress from the movie Prime Suspect). Here is a summary of the movie taken from a fan Killing Mrs. Tingle movie site (link no longer available):
Just as young, pretty and popular Leigh Ann is preparing to graduate from high school, her future seems bright and wide-open to possibilities. But when another classmate sets Leigh Ann up in her History class she receives a failing mark from that classroom's teacher, the much-feared and despised Mrs. Tingle. Because of that one black mark, Leigh Ann loses the opportunity to be her school's valedictorian, an opening that Mary Beth, the rival student who framed Leigh Ann, is quick to seize. With her post-graduation dreams swiftly eroding away, Leigh Ann comes up with the only option available to her. Before school lets out for the summer, Mrs. Tingle's History class is going to need a substitute teacher."
This is a semi-autobiographical work for Kevin Williamson, although it is in fact loosely-based on the book "Killing Mr. Griffin" by the writer of I Know What You Did Last Summer (Lois Duncan).Williamson is directing and it is set for an August 1999 release.
The movie was originally titled Killing Mrs. Tingle, but it is said that the shooting incident at Columbine High School in Littleton, Colorado, persuaded the studios to change the title (true or false)
